DIN 1.4439

Stainless steel Din 1.4439 tubing is a type of tubing made from an alloy with a combination of elements such as chromium, nickel, molybdenum, and titanium. This composition of metals makes it a highly durable and corrosion-resistant material, which outperforms many other tubings in various industrial applications. Its chemical components or grades further enhance its mechanical properties, allowing it to resist undue stress or heat strain when welding or drilling. The stainless steel Din 1.4439 material also has extraordinary ductile strength, making it ideal for high-pressure applications such as pressure vessels and piping systems. All these diverse characteristics make this metal alluring for industries seeking a reliable and enduring material with which to work.

Din 1.4439 Stainless Steel Tubing has high strength and provides excellent corrosion resistance. It is suitable for various industrial applications, including marine, petrochemical, and process engineering. The structure makes it ideal for piping for transporting chemicals to hydraulic components, heat exchangers, and condensers. This tubing can tolerate temperatures up to 600 Celsius without deforming or losing its properties. Additionally, it is highly resistant to acids and alkalis in many concentrations and forms, making it a preferred choice in the food industry. Another great feature of this stainless steel tubing is its low thermal expansion which increases process stability and reduces maintenance time. These exceptional qualities make SS Din 1.4439 Tubing an excellent choice for almost any application requiring a durable tubing material that offers superior performance and durability.

Stainless Steel Din 1.4439 Tubing can be welded using a MIG or TIG welding process, however the most commonly used is TIG welding as it produces a stronger, more reliable joint. Before proceeding with any welding, ensure that both surfaces of the tubing are thoroughly cleaned of dirt and other contaminants. Additionally, use back-purging to protect against oxidation and keep the weld clean – this involves applying an inert gas inside the tube during welding in order to displace air and reduce contamination.
